Output 7cf56eb01c28b160f1eed3cc7e423add441e2eb1ce69682772077f6026a68c8a:1

value
17783
script pubkey
OP_0 OP_PUSHBYTES_20 e890709bb928b8462a8d63c0a4810e43ad3979d6
address
tb1qazg8pxae9zuyv25dv0q2fqgwgwknj7wkfj7hzf
transaction
7cf56eb01c28b160f1eed3cc7e423add441e2eb1ce69682772077f6026a68c8a
confirmations
82572
spent
true